Do I need planning permission?
Short answer: No. Typically, our garden rooms do not require planning permission.
(Assuming you don’t live in a listed building and your home isn’t in a designated area (e.g. a National Park, or an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ty AONB)
However, if you’d like to know why garden rooms don’t typically need planning permission, here are the rules:
- Your garden room isn’t positioned in front of your house (if you’ve extended your home, the ‘front’ refers to how it stood on 1st July 1948).
- The combined area of all extensions, sheds, and outbuildings – including your proposed garden room – must not exceed 50% of the total land area surrounding your house (again, this refers to the area as it was on 1st July 1948).
- It is single-storey and less than 3 metres high (4 metres if it has a dual-pitched roof).
- If it’s within 2 metres of your boundary.
- The eaves are no higher than 2.5 metres above ground level.
- It doesn’t have a balcony, veranda, or raised platform.
- It isn’t designed to be self-contained living accommodation.
